Details
A vulnerability classified as problematic was found in Samsung Wearable Processor Exynos 980, 850, 1080, 1280, 1330, 1380, 1480, W920, W930 and W1000. This vulnerability affects the function STOP_KEEP_ALIVE_OFFLOAD.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a out-of-bounds v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-125. The product reads data past the end, or before the beginning, of the intended buffer. As an impact it is known to affect confidentiality. CVE summarizes:
An issue was discovered in Samsung Mobile Processor and Wearable Processor Exynos 980, 850, 1080, 1280, 1330, 1380, 1480, W920, W930, and W1000. Lack of a boundary check in STOP_KEEP_ALIVE_OFFLOAD leads to out-of-bounds access. An attacker can send a malformed message to the target through the Wi-Fi driver.
The advisory is available at semiconductor.samsung.com. This vulnerability was named CVE-2024-50600 since 10/27/2024. Technical details are known, but there is no available exploit.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
